Serve these with GFCF butter, syrup, or just plain. The kids love them as a side to eggs or toasted with nut butter for lunch.

Dry Ingredients

2-1/2 cups GF all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ons sugar
2 teaspoons GF baking powder (Featherweight)

 

Wet Ingredients

4 eggs
2 cups GFCF yogurt (Silk plain, vanilla, or even fruit)
2 tablespoons oil

1) Preheat waffle iron.
2) Whisk together dry ingredients in a medium bowl.
3) In a separate bowl, whisk eggs until lightly beaten. Then, add yogurt and oil, and whisk to combine. Stir wet ingredients into the dry ones, just until combined.
4) Spoon into hot waffle iron. Bake until golden brown. Makes 18, 4-inch waffles.

 

Creative Alternative

You can use Silk vanilla or fruit flavored yogurt for a delicious Belgium-like waffle. You may want to reduce sugar since these yogurts are sweeter than the plain variety.
